City Of Collinsville Transforms 4th Of July Celebration Into Virtual Event

Collinsville City officials say they will be moving the city's 4th of July parade to a virtual format.

The city announced on Tuesday that they would be canceling the event due to COVID-19 concerns. The City is now asking local businesses, families, previous float registrants, and others to submit fun pictures or videos of up to 30 seconds to be used during the presentation.

The photos should feature "Overall Patriotism! Honoring the U.S.A. and the freedoms we enjoy!"

The event will also honor the Class of 2020 as well as first responders and healthcare workers. Those who want to submit photos or videos are asked to send them to scampbell@cityofcollinsville no later than July 2, 2020. The Virtual 4th of July Parade will be posted online on Saturday, July 4th, 2020.
